Transaction 767c656de6a6933c99b32f8b439b9f874a11beda37586ef757a0a65f6fb8865f
1 Input
1 Output
-
767c656de6a6933c99b32f8b439b9f874a11beda37586ef757a0a65f6fb8865f:0
- value
- 291815
- script pubkey
- OP_0 OP_PUSHBYTES_20 581abb7aa8a196cc2498da739ef0961c1e7b5103
- address
- bc1qtqdtk74g5xtvcfycmfeeauykrs08k5grfvv2z6